    Hi JandL
    the images for the Scotland census enumeration books are only available on ScotlandsPeople, I believe, which is a pay per view site.
    The cost is 1 credit to view the index and 5 credits to view the actual page from the enumerator's book.

    For a pay to use site, it's reasonably cheap. 7 pounds gets you 30 credits. I estimate that all of the info you've requested will cost you about 25 credits, and you'll have downloaded copies of the 01 and 11 census forms and the death certs.
    The index to the wills is free, I can't remember how many credits a download costs.
